Refs #30581 -- Moved CheckConstraint tests for conditional expressions to migrations.test_operations.

This allows avoiding warning in tests about using RawSQL in
CheckConstraints.

+    @skipUnlessDBFeature("supports_table_check_constraints")
+    def test_create_model_with_boolean_expression_in_check_constraint(self):
+        app_label = "test_crmobechc"
+        rawsql_constraint = models.CheckConstraint(
+            check=models.expressions.RawSQL(
+                "price < %s", (1000,), output_field=models.BooleanField()
+            ),
+            name=f"{app_label}_price_lt_1000_raw",
+        )
+        wrapper_constraint = models.CheckConstraint(
+            check=models.expressions.ExpressionWrapper(
+                models.Q(price__gt=500) | models.Q(price__lt=500),
+                output_field=models.BooleanField(),
+            ),
+            name=f"{app_label}_price_neq_500_wrap",
+        )
+        operation = migrations.CreateModel(
+            "Product",
+            [
+                ("id", models.AutoField(primary_key=True)),
+                ("price", models.IntegerField(null=True)),
+            ],
+            options={"constraints": [rawsql_constraint, wrapper_constraint]},
+        )
+
+        project_state = ProjectState()
+        new_state = project_state.clone()
+        operation.state_forwards(app_label, new_state)
+        # Add table.
+        self.assertTableNotExists(app_label)
+        with connection.schema_editor() as editor:
+            operation.database_forwards(app_label, editor, project_state, new_state)
+        self.assertTableExists(f"{app_label}_product")
+        insert_sql = f"INSERT INTO {app_label}_product (id, price) VALUES (%d, %d)"
+        with connection.cursor() as cursor:
+            with self.assertRaises(IntegrityError):
+                cursor.execute(insert_sql % (1, 1000))
+            cursor.execute(insert_sql % (1, 999))
+            with self.assertRaises(IntegrityError):
+                cursor.execute(insert_sql % (2, 500))
+            cursor.execute(insert_sql % (2, 499))
